NFL Week 13 active/inactive list: Arian Foster, Jordan Reed suiting up; Lavonte David, Jadeveon Clowney out

Who's in and who's out for Week 13 of the NFL season? We're tracking all the key actives and inactives for this Sunday's action.

Active

Arian Foster, RB, Texans (groin): When Foster has been on the field this season, he has been borderline unstoppable, rushing for 822 yards in eight games. Sunday's matchup with the hapless Titans run defense offers another opportunity for a big day, even if Foster is at slightly less than 100 percent.

Jordan Reed, TE, Redskins (hamstring): Instability at quarterback and Reed's own nagging injuries have limited the second-year tight end's production in 2014. He will try to get back on track Sunday at Indianapolis, with QB Colt McCoy running the offense.

Odell Beckham Jr., WR, Giants (back): New York's emerging superstar was almost a cursory inclusion on the injury report this week, listed as probable as he participated in every practice leading up to Sunday's matchup with Jacksonville. Eli Manning should target him early and often. 

Cordarrelle Patterson, WR, Vikings (knee, ankle): Despite being in and out of practice this week, Patterson will suit up in Week 13. He is Minnesota's second-leading receiver with 350 yards, although he has topped the 50-yard mark just once in his previous eight games. 

Mike Tolbert, RB, Panthers (knee): Inexplicably, the Panthers are right in the NFC South title hunt despite a 3-7-1 record and six-game winless streak. Their playoff push will get a little boost Sunday in the presence of Tolbert, who has spent eight games on short-term injured reserve.

Inactive

Lavonte David, LB, Buccaneers (hamstring): Tampa Bay's defensive leader will miss a second consecutive game. Tampa Bay entered the weekend with David listed as questionable, but he was ruled out Sunday morning.

Jerick McKinnon, RB, Vikings (back): McKinnon broke the news Friday that he would be a no-go against the Panthers. The rookie has emerged as Minnesota's leading rusher -- 538 yards so far this season -- so the onus will fall on Matt Asiata and Ben Tate to keep the ground game moving in McKinnon's stead. 

Latavius Murray, RB, Raiders (head): Murray suffered a concussion during  last Thursday's upset of Kansas City -- he rushed for 112 yards and two touchdowns before suffering the injury. The Raiders ruled him out for Week 13 action earlier this week.

Jadeveon Clowney, LB, Texans (knee): Bordering on a lost rookie season for the No. 1 overall pick, who admitted he's feeling discomfort in his surgically repaired right knee. Clowney has played just four games for the Texans this season and has yet to record his first career sack.

Justin Gilbert, CB, Browns (illness): Another top-10 pick struggling through year one, Gilbert will sit Sunday. How much of a hit is that to the Browns as they take on Buffalo? Probably not much. Gilbert did not play any snaps last week. The Browns also will be without TE Jordan Cameron (head) and S Tashaun Gipson (knee), though they're hoping to have Cameron back by Week 14.
